Dorchester Minerals Q1 net income jumps 65.15% to $29.14 million; revenue rises 36.41% to $58.88 million
  • Dorchester Minerals posted net income of USD 29.14 million, or USD 0.59 per common unit, for quarter ended March 31, 2026.
  • Operating revenues climbed to USD 58.88 million from USD 43.16 million a year earlier.
  • Net income rose to USD 29.14 million from USD 17.64 million in prior-year quarter.
  • First-quarter distribution set at USD 0.475036 per common unit, payable May 14 to unitholders of record May 4.
